Recently, Toyota has announced that Prii is the new plural for their highly reputed brand, Prius.

The new name Prii was decided by online voting.

Unique branding strategy
The Japanese car maker holds a dominant market share, all over the world and they certainly know how to increase their sales by promoting their successful breed of cars more efficiently.

Branding helps any company to reach its target audience more effectively and Toyota has planned up an interesting customer interactive strategy, to make this new branding move more acceptable by their loyal fans.

With the Obama administration fixing a goal of putting 1 million electric cars on the road by 2015, all kind of proposals are being discussed to achieve this aim.

A report issued by the U.S. Department of Energy (DOE) said that the goal is achievable.

The report issued on Tuesday, tried to convince that the goal can be achieved and the government has already invested heavily in the electric cars, in the last two years.

Government aims at 1 million electric cars
The government has also tightened the fuel economy standards, to drive automakers towards making electric vehicles.

One among the grand advertisements that we get to see during the Super bowl will be a new ad by the Mercedes-Benz, featuring a hilarious act by Sean “Diddy” Combs.

A glance of the 60 second advertisement that will be telecasted during the game, was released by the company.

The ad is catchy
The ad is fun to watch. All the Mercedes-Benzes are called home. The cars come from everywhere throughout the world, ranging from America to as far as the Sahara desert.

All the cars assemble at a place which resembles Stuttgart, where they meet the new models offered by Mercedes Benz.

It appears to be a smart plan, whereby the company is planning to showcase its rich heritage along with the new models that it is planning for the future.
